Centralisation or decentralisation for a company is an integral part of governance. It’s a question of risk, consistency, and speed. If you centralise everything, you gain control… but you often create bottlenecks. If you decentralise everything, you gain speed… but you can end up with confusion and inconsistency. The right model is often hybrid: ✅ Centralise the rules of the game: standards, frameworks, thresholds, KPIs, risk management, etc. ✅ Decentralise execution within the centralised rules: day-to-day decisions, local adaptation Simple criteria to decide: High risk → centraliseNeed for consistency → centraliseNeed for speed & proximity → decentraliseScarce expertise → centraliseWell-trained, stable local teams → further decentraliseThe more you grow → the more you standardise and the more you clarify delegation.
